Rising Roll Gourmet Café to Bring Fresh Dining Options to BullStreet
Rising Roll Gourmet Café, renowned for its fresh, local and innovative menu, will become a key part of the University of South Carolina’s (USC) new Health Sciences Campus in the City of Columbia’s BullStreet District, the first phase of which, USC’s new School of Medicine Columbia, is scheduled for completion in August 2027.
Once open, the café will offer high-quality food and beverage options in a convenient and welcoming environment for students, faculty and staff, as well as the broader community.
The Rising Roll Gourmet Café is part of Aramark’s contracted vendor services with USC, chosen for its ability to deliver a diverse menu of gourmet sandwiches, salads, breakfast items, and specialty coffees catering to the fast-paced lifestyles of students, faculty and staff at the Health Sciences Campus, as well as visitors to the BullStreet District. USC’s new School of Medicine Columbia is an ambitious initiative that will develop a modern, state-of-the-art facility, focusing on timely and cost-effective delivery while fostering innovation and collaboration in biomedical education and research. This cutting-edge campus will feature modern classrooms, advanced clinical simulation spaces, an ultrasound lab, research labs and the Rising Roll Gourmet Caf é location. Additionally, a green quadrangle space will provide an ideal environment for outdoor study and events, enhancing the overall educational experience for students, faculty and staff.
In addition to Gilbane Development Company and Gilbane Building Company, other key project team members include lead design architect SLAM Collaborative collaborating with local architect BOUDREAUX, construction manager Cummings, construction manager and minority business Brownstone Construction Group, and development consultant and minority- and women-owned business Restoration 52.
USC’s new School of Medicine Columbia will officially break ground on January 23, 2025, with completion scheduled for August 2027.
